The Role of Proprietary Software in Peripheral Customization: A Case Study of Cepter Keyboard Software
Modern mechanical keyboards have evolved from simple input devices into complex, highly customizable peripherals tailored for both competitive gaming and professional workflows Gaming Keyboards - CEPTER. Brands like Cepter
have entered the budget-to-mid-range market by offering feature-rich hardware, such as gasket-mounted builds and mechanical switches Cepter Titan Pro gaming keyboard
. However, the hardware represents only half of the ecosystem; the accompanying software driver serves as the bridge between raw input and user intent. This paper examines the functionality, user interface, and overall utility of Cepter keyboard software, evaluating how it balances accessibility with advanced scripting and lighting controls. 1. Introduction
The gaming peripheral market is heavily saturated with options ranging from high-end enthusiast boards to entry-level budget models. Within this landscape, Cepter has carved out a niche by delivering mechanical keyboards with premium-adjacent features (such as hot-swappable options, linear switches, and gasket structures) at accessible price points Cepter Titan Pro gaming keyboard
While physical attributes like switch actuation and acoustics heavily dictate the typing experience, software customization dictates the operational efficiency Gaming Keyboards - CEPTER. Cepter's dedicated keyboard software allows users to modify the native behavior of the board. This paper analyzes the core pillars of this software: RGB illumination control, macro programming, and key remapping. 2. Core Software Functionalities 2.1 RGB Illumination and Visual Customization
One of the primary selling points of modern gaming keyboards is aesthetic personalization via light-emitting diodes (LEDs). Cepter software provides a graphical user interface (GUI) to manipulate these arrays. cepter keyboard software
Preset Profiles: The software includes standard lighting behaviors such as breathing, wave, static, and reactive typing effects.
Per-Key Customization: For advanced users, the software allows independent color assignment to specific keys CEPTER CZETATKL Gaming Keyboard User Manual. This is particularly useful for creating color-coded maps for complex video games or productivity shortcuts in digital audio workstations (DAWs) and video editors. 2.2 Macro Programming and Key Remapping
Beyond aesthetics, the software's primary utility lies in its command structure modification capabilities Cepter Zeta Full Size mechanical gaming keyboard
Macro Recording: Users can record a sequence of keystrokes and mouse clicks, including precise millisecond delays between actions Cepter Zeta Full Size mechanical gaming keyboard
. This is vital for executing complex combos in massive multiplayer online (MMO) games or automating repetitive text strings in office environments.
Key Remapping: The software allows full remapping of the layout Cepter Zeta Full Size mechanical gaming keyboard
. Users can change the native function of any key, allowing them to shift primary functions closer to the left-hand home row or disable disruptive keys (like the Windows key) during active gameplay. 3. User Experience and Interface Analysis
While the feature set of Cepter's software covers the necessary industry baselines, its execution reveals the challenges common to mid-tier peripheral brands.
Simplicity vs. Depth: The software favors a lightweight, low-resource profile over the heavy, ecosystem-locking hubs found in competitors. This results in faster boot times and lower background CPU usage.
On-Board Memory Integration: A critical component of the Cepter ecosystem is the ability to save customized profiles directly to the keyboard's internal hardware memory CEPTER CZETATKL Gaming Keyboard User Manual. This allows users to retain their macros and lighting settings when moving the keyboard to a different computer without needing to reinstall the driver software. 4. Conclusion
Cepter keyboard software successfully fulfills its role as a necessary companion to the brand's mechanical hardware Gaming Keyboards - CEPTER. By providing functional macro controls, robust remapping, and accessible RGB manipulation, it elevates budget hardware into highly versatile tools Cepter Zeta Full Size mechanical gaming keyboard
. While it lacks some of the hyper-advanced cloud synchronization and active game-state integration found in premium peripheral ecosystems, its low system overhead and hardware-level profile saving make it a reliable utility for daily users.

Cepter keyboard software is a specialized utility designed to manage and personalize the functionality of Cepter's mechanical gaming keyboards. While entry-level models or specific combo kits often rely on onboard hardware controls—such as the audio-wheel
key combinations to cycle through lighting—premium models like the Cepter Rogue Cepter Zeta Cepter Wrath
are compatible with dedicated driver software to unlock advanced customisation. Core Functionality
The software serves as a bridge between the physical hardware and the user's digital environment, focusing on three primary pillars of customisation: Macro Programming
: Users can record complex command sequences and assign them to any key. This is particularly useful in competitive gaming for executing intricate combos or in professional workflows for streamlining repetitive tasks. Per-Key RGB Customisation
: Unlike the static presets found on some budget models, the software allows for granular control over individual key lighting. Users can choose from millions of colors, set dynamic effects, or use pre-configured profiles for specific game genres like FPS or MOBA. Key Remapping
: The software enables complete re-configuration of the keyboard layout. Every key can be remapped to perform a different function, allowing users to tailor their equipment to their specific ergonomic or gaming needs. Software Availability by Model

Cepter vs. Competitors: How the Software Stacks Up
How does Cepter Keyboard Software compare to giants like Logitech G Hub or Razer Synapse?
| Feature | Cepter Software | Logitech G Hub | Razer Synapse | | :--- | :--- | :--- | :--- | | File Size | ~50 MB (Lightweight) | ~500 MB (Bloat-heavy) | ~400 MB | | RAM Usage | ~30 MB | ~300 MB | ~250 MB | | Cloud Sync | Rare (Usually local) | Yes | Yes | | Learning Curve | Low (Beginner friendly) | Moderate | High | | Macro Complexity | Basic (Keystroke only) | Advanced (Includes mouse & delays) | Advanced |
Verdict: Cepter software is not as flashy as premium brands, but it is resource-light and stable. It does exactly what you need without nagging you to create an account or showing ads.

Tab 1: Key Assignment
This is the remapping hub. Click any key on the virtual keyboard displayed on your screen.
- Single Key: Change ‘A’ to ‘B’.
- Multimedia: Assign play/pause, volume up/down, or calculator.
- Launch App: Open Spotify, Chrome, or File Explorer with a dedicated key.
- Disable Key: Perfect for turning off Caps Lock if you never use it.
